SAGINAW'S OLDER CORE

Why the shaded streets near Knowles Drive get chiggers and the newer edges mostly do not

Central Saginaw was built decades ago under trees that are now 40-plus years old, and the leaf litter and damp shade those trees create is chigger habitat. The newer sections on the south and west edges, toward Lake Worth, have thinner canopy and more open lawn, and chiggers are rarely the complaint there.

The tell is the bite pattern. Chiggers climb until clothing stops them, so the welts cluster at the sock line, the waistband and behind the knees rather than scattering. If you spent an evening in a shaded Saginaw yard and woke up with that ring of bites, the mite larvae in your grass are the cause, not fleas.

BE HONEST ABOUT THIS PART

When chigger control in Saginaw is not worth buying

If your Saginaw lot is one of the open, sunny ones on the newer edges with no trees and a closely mowed lawn, you probably do not have chiggers, and we would rather say that than sell you a yard plan for them. Check the bite pattern first. Random bites are mosquitoes; clustered bites at tight clothing are chiggers.

In the older core the treatment works, but it cannot get through a mat of old pecan leaves. The chiggers overwinter under that litter and the product sits on top of it. A shaded Saginaw yard that never gets raked will keep flaring in the same corner, treated or not.

Small lots also mean close neighbors, and chiggers do not respect a chain-link fence. If the yard next door is unmowed with brush along the shared line, some larvae will keep crossing. Treatment on your side lowers the pressure substantially, but it is not an absolute barrier.

PLAN VERSUS A RAKE

What a Saturday of yard work buys you versus what the plan buys you

Raking out the leaf litter, mowing the edges tight and trimming brush off the fence line costs nothing and removes the shade and moisture chiggers depend on. On a small Saginaw lot that is a manageable job, and it should be done regardless. Sulfur dust adds a short-lived repellent effect but washes off with the first storm.

The year-round plan treats the whole lawn, heaviest at the shaded edges, and puts a three-foot band at every door so larvae are not walked inside. It also covers retreatments between scheduled visits at no charge. The honest split: open lot, do the yard work and skip the plan; shaded older lot, do the yard work and get the plan.

How long does chigger season last in Saginaw?

May through August, with the worst weeks in the humid part of June and July. Shaded older yards start a little sooner than the open newer ones, because the ground under canopy warms and stays damp earlier.

Why do the bites itch for days if the chigger is gone?

Because the itch comes from your reaction to the feeding tube the larva leaves in the skin, not from the mite still being there. Chiggers do not burrow, despite the myth; they feed for a while and drop off.

Will one treatment fix a chigger problem in my Saginaw yard?

Usually not on its own. Most yards need two or three across the season, which is why chigger control is part of a year-round plan rather than a single spray, and why retreatments between visits are covered.
